在Java中,我们可以使用类来设置文件读取的编码格式。
是一个将字节流转换为字符流的桥梁,而且它还可以接收一个字符集名称作为参数,以指定字符编码。
以下是一个使用设置文件读取编码为UTF-8的例子:
在这个例子中,我们创建了一个新的,并将文件输入流和字符编码作为参数传入。
二、设置文件写入的编码格式
类似地,我们可以使用类来设置文件写入的编码格式。
是一个将字符流转换为字节流的桥梁,同样可以接收一个字符集名称作为参数,以指定字符编码。

在这个例子中,我们创建了一个新的,并将文件输出流和字符编码作为参数传入。
在处理文件编码时,可能会出现不支持的字符集异常()。
这通常发生在我们尝试使用不支持的字符集名称时。
为了处理这种异常,我们可以使用try-catch语句来捕获它:
在这个例子中,我们试图使用一个不支持的编码来读取文件。
当出现时,我们会捕获它并打印错误消息。
在Java文件读写操作中,正确地设置编码格式是非常重要的,它可以避免出现乱码问题,确保我们的数据能够正确地被读取和写入。

本文来源:vps主机--Java文件读写编码格式设置(java读取文件乱码问题)
本文地址:https://www.idcbaba.com/vps/4016.html
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 1919100645@qq.com 举报,一经查实,本站将立刻删除。



